Apple iCloud trademark for Europe, Apple cracks down on giveaways of iPhone, students may get iCloud discount





Apple’s has filed its iCloud trademark in Europe right in time for WWDC where the service is expected to go official. The European trademark for the service was field yesterday.

A report has surfaced that Apple is cracking down on third parties that are giving away things like the iPhone and iPad as promotions. The provision has been around for a while and states that Apple iPhone, iPad and other gear can’t be used in third-party promotions.

A student discount for access to iCloud is very possible according to some sources. Apple is big on educational discounts so I don’t think anyone would be surprised.
